OK, I'm a bit old school and am very familiar with my 2002 TJ. It's manual and very much hands on. The most advanced thing I have is ARB lockers. Having a hand throttle is my only 'trick'. This new JLURD has some fairly alien tech beyond anything I'm used to. Trying to figure out when to use the OR+ and SSC. Can they be used together? I gather SSC is kinda like hill descent but more(seen it in action but no experience). When would OR+ be used, or not used? Planning on a small outing to testing things out while it's still completely stock. Any advice or links would be appreciated.

I have used Off Road Plus and Select Speed Control together. SSC is also good for speed control climbing uphills and for climbing over obstacles on the trail. OR+ is also great for sand as it allows for more wheel spin when needed. OR+ also changes the throttle calibration by providing less gain which is great on rough trails.
